CVE-2025-36065 is a medium-severity Insufficient Session Expiration (CWE-613) vulnerability in Ibm Sterling Connect\. Its CVSS base score is 6.3 (Medium).
Operationally, ranked at the 5th percentile by exploit likelihood (below the median); it is not currently listed in the CISA KEV catalog.

IBM Sterling Connect:Express Adapter for Sterling B2B Integrator 5.2.0 5.2.0.00 through 5.2.0.12 does not invalidate session after a browser closure which could allow an authenticated user to impersonate another user on the system.

Mitigating Controls (NIST 800-53 r5) AI
Directly requires automatic session termination on defined events such as browser closure, eliminating the exact CWE-613 flaw that permits impersonation.
Enforces access decisions on every request using current session state, so an unexpired post-closure session would be rejected if the control validates termination status.
Forces re-authentication after events like browser closure, preventing continued use of the stale session that the CVE leaves valid.
